Mountain Cottage of Italian Architect
When it comes to houses of architects and designers, you usually expect something unconventional and original. The mountain cottage of Italian architect Fancesca Neri Antonello in the Swiss Alps turned out exactly that way: an old 150-year-old barn was restored and transformed into stylish housing with character for a creative family. Some interior elements were designed by the homeowner herself, in addition to that, the house is full of furniture and accessories from well-known design brands.
